Butcher's Shop In North Street

A Memory of Guildford.

I am looking for photos of Guildford in the 50s, particularly North street and wondered if anyone remembered the Butcher's shop in North street in the 50s. I was born there, we lived in a flat over the shop and I have vivid memories of watching the carnival from the window. I also remember there was an abattoir at the back of the shop. I think the shop was called Colebrooks.

We didn't live there for long, possibly around 1948ish - 52 then moved to Walnut Tree Close by the station. Sadly neither place exist any more.

I would be grateful for any memories as I am wondeering if I dreamt it all.
